What is a mini-moon? It’s the abridged version of a honeymoon. Rather than planning, funding, and executing a week-long (or more) trip immediately following an exhausting, expensive wedding, a mini-moon offers enough time away with your significant other to relax, indulge, and have fun without going overboard. Some may still choose to go on a bigger trip some months after the wedding, but a mini-moon is the deep breath we all need before diving back into work and routine.

Though far less tedious than orchestrating a honeymoon (while also planning a wedding), a mini-moon does require a bit of planning. For my own trip, here’s what I locked in ahead of time:

  • A place to stay
  • Transportation
  • A few activities
  • Some places to eat

My wife and I decided to stay just far enough away to feel the urge to explore, but close enough not to waste too much time getting there. That turned out to be San Clemente, California, a 45-minute drive from our apartment in Costa Mesa. We briefly considered booking a hotel in town, but after seeing the prices for four-star rooms, we turned to Airbnb.

A five-minute search produced three or four highly reviewed private residences. We settled on an ideally located bungalow that cost about as much for two nights as one night at a nearby hotel. Better still, the Airbnb owner offered beach chairs, towels, surfboards, and bikes for us to use while staying with him.

Finding transportation won’t look the same for everyone. If you’re mini-mooning close to home and want a cost-effective option, you may decide to take your own car or even Uber to and from the destination. If, however, you want to class-up your adventure, consider renting an exotic car. Enterprise, Hertz, Turo, and other vehicle loan services offer high-end vehicles alongside their standard models.

When scoping activities and dining for your mini-moon, try to keep it simple. Build in time to lounge, cuddle, and just enjoy each other’s company. Loading up a handful of days with pursuits can create stress and distract you from the present moment. My wife and I built our trip around one key activity and one or two food/coffee joints each day. Apart from the reservations we made in the evening, nothing had a set schedule, so the pressure was off.

Gipe Photography

The night of our arrival, we ran into some old friends who recommended a few eateries and a good hike in the area. The rest of our meals and adventures during our stay came from Yelp and good old-fashioned exploration. Our loosely constructed plans left room to bike along the coast for an hour longer than planned, shop at some outlet stores we stumbled upon on the way back from our hike, and swing by a coffee shop a local recommended.

Striking the right balance of fun and leisure is important, and taking a bit of time before your wedding to map out a place to stay, a way to get around, and some activities will go a long way to helping you relax with your life partner. Whether you watch movies in bed for two days or complete an iron man, the best way to maximize your mini-moon is simply to spend quality time together away from the burden of routine.

Connecticut cigars are the clear winner for smoking on a hot summer day, in the morning with some coffee, or when you just don't want a swift kick in the teeth (of pepper). There's no shortage of options, either. Connecticut shade wrappers are one of the most prevalent in the world of cigars, and it's certainly the most common natural shade. Maduro is also popular, but the two wrapper types couldn't be any more different. Connecticut wrappers, and by proxy Connecticut cigars, are typically mild to medium in strength and brimming with creamy, smooth flavors. They're composed of tobacco leaves grown in the Connecticut River Valley in the United States -- which is where the name Connecticut comes from. Consistent and flavorful, some of the best beginner-friendly cigars are Connecticut-wrapped, but you should never sell them short. A Connecticut shade cigar can be just as refined, elegant, and premium as any other. If you know where to look, you may even find some of your favorite blends in the category across a wide range of brands and cigar makers.
